Doubly linked list c implementation
WebA doubly linked list is a linear data structure where each node has a link to the next node as well as to the previous node. Each component of a doubly linked list has three components. prev: It is a pointer that points to the … WebApr 6,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…
Doubly linked list c implementation
Did you know?
WebA Doubly Linked List in C is a unique type of Data Structure where there are a chain of nodes, that are connected to one another using pointers, where any individual node has … WebNov 7, 2024 · Figure 5.6.1: A doubly linked list. The most common reason to use a doubly linked list is because it is easier to implement than a singly linked list. While the code for the doubly linked implementation is a little longer than for the singly linked version, it tends to be a bit more “obvious” in its intention, and so easier to implement and ...
WebNov 6, 2013 · Paradigm shift. Consider a double-link-list with no NULL pointers. Rather make the full circle. Last->next = First. First->prev = Last. Then instead of of while loop … WebMay 25, 2024 · A doubly linked list (DLL) is a special type of linked list in which each node contains a pointer to the previous node as well as the next node of the linked list. …
Web1. Simulate the implementation of a doubly linked list . The bottom layer of LinkedList is a doubly linked list, so let's implement a doubly linked list. We first need to create a class to implement such a linked list: public class DLinkedList {} Next, we need to put all the process of implementing the linked list in the DLinkedList class WebApr 12, 2024 · /* * C++ Program to Implement Doubly Linked List */ #include #include #include /* * Node Declaration */ using namespace std; struct node { int info; struct nod…
WebApr 6, 2024 · Practice. Video. A Doubly Linked List (DLL) contains an extra pointer, typically called the previous pointer, together with the next pointer and data which are there in a singly linked list. Below are operations on the given DLL: Add a node at the front of DLL: The new node is always added before the head of the given Linked List.
WebFeb 23, 2024 · You create nodes of doubly-linked lists using classes or structures. These nodes are then linked with each other using the next and the previous pointer. Code: //A … leather chair frames made out ofWebFascinating Number or Not in C and CPP; Implement queue using linked list c program; Calculate the GCD Euclidean algorithm c and cpp programming language; Linear search in c Algorithm of Linear search c programming; A C program for checking whether a given line is a comment; C program to convert decimal to binary without array leather chair for waxing eyebrowsWebLearn to implement concept of doubly linked list with the help of programming in c, step by step detailed explanation.#dsa #datastructuresandalgorithms #doub... how to download java 17 for minecraftWebJul 28, 2024 · A node in a doubly linked list contains a data item and a node pointer to the next node. In a singly linked list we can traverse only in one direction. The first node of the linked list is the ... how to download java 6 update 25WebA lin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ked list Data Structure. You have to start somewhere, so we give the address of the first node a special name called HEAD. Also, the last node in the linked list can be identified ... how to download java 18WebDec 14, 2024 · Introduction to Doubly Linked List: A doubly linked list, also called a double-linked list, is a type of linked list data structure in which each node contains … leather chair free vectorWebNov 6, 2013 · Paradigm shift. Consider a double-link-list with no NULL pointers. Rather make the full circle. Last->next = First. First->prev = Last. Then instead of of while loop that goes until p->next == NULL, loop until p->next == first. The list simply points to the first node (or NULL if empty). how to download java 19